The Original Concept: Coloured Liquid-Filled ‘Bottle’ Appliques
Foolish, but we really wanted to make this happen. So, we got working through the various technical challenges this presented us with:
-
- What material do we use for the bottles? And how do we construct these? Hand or machine-made?
- What about the thickness of the material?
- How do we fill the bottles? And with what? And yes, how do we seal the bottles once filled?
- How do we attach the bottles to the garment?
We created various hand-made prototypes and thought we were nearly there…however, we felt the liquid-filled concept still needed more work to be a safe and viable option – despite being very close. The Final Concept: Coloured Glass Microbead-Filled ‘Bottle’ Appliques
After much deliberation, we decided to use a safer medium to fill our bottles: coloured glass microbeads. We landed on utilising flexible transparent PVC sheet for the bottles, which were ultrasonically welded using bottle-shaped dies. We then hand-filled the bottles with microbeads, hot-sealed and sewed onto the sweatshirts. For the bottle caps, we used soft enamel and epoxy pieces, stamped using a shaped-die in silver metal, red and yellow colourings.
The ‘Soda and Magic Potion’ sweatshirts were now alive. Following our most technically challenging garment thus far; we loved the results; bright, soft, shiny and flexible appliques on contrasting colours. The appliques are a joy to touch and feel against beautiful French Terry cotton.
